दुख में सुमिरन सब करे, सुख में करे न कोय I
जो सुख में सुमिरन करे, दुख काहे को होय II


 "We are basically like large toddlers. I can do it! I can do it! Me do it!” That is our daily cry, until all of a sudden we fall down and scrape our knee and then mommy is the only person that matters in this world. It’s like our trials are a reminder that we can’t do life on our own. We can be plugging along in life unaware that we’ve forgotten God until WHAM! God smacks us in the face with a challenge and then we go crawling back to Him in desperation and regret for ever walking away.
Kabir says, rejoice always, pray without ceasing, give thanks in all circumstances; for whether we “feel” like it or not, we need God with every breath we breathe. We need to be in constant conversation with Him, to be dwelling on His name.
God isn’t the one that only rushes in at the last minute. He isn’t absent. He isn’t content to let us fail. He is there at all times, waiting for us to seek Him. And what better time to seek Him than when we can come to Him in pure thankfulness for the GOOD things He is doing in our lives. One who rejoices the constant contemplation of God through His name in all circumstances unconditionally lives a life of perpetual ecstasy, living in the world but not of the world."
